WebOct 14, 2024 · Regarding ESOP, the bone of contention between the employer Assessee and the tax department is on the tax deductibility of ESOP expense in the hands of employer Assessee. The employer Assessee claims it as tax deductible business expense stating that it should be allowable to the employer as salary expense. How Much Tax Do You Pay On An ESOP Distribution?

WebSep 7, 2024 · Where an ESOP owns 30% of a company, no tax is due on that 30% of its income; with a 100% ESOP-owned company, there is no tax at all (again, this is true for federal taxes and often state taxes). This is not an unintentional loophole; it was specifically created by Congress to encourage ESOPs.
